PuzzleMask is a newly disclosed technique that allows attackers to embed malicious payloads within plain prose, bypassing LLM-based policy checks. This method exploits the resource asymmetry between a fast gatekeeper model and a more capable target model. In tests, 23 crafted prompts successfully evaded detection by four different LLM gatekeepers, achieving a 100% miss rate. The downstream target model, gpt-5-thinking, executed the embedded payload in approximately 94% of trials. This attack does not involve traditional obfuscation techniques, making it particularly insidious. The technique has implications for various applications of LLMs, which are increasingly used in sensitive tasks. AI labs are encouraged to enhance their defenses against such prompt injection methods. Current mitigation strategies include using paraphrasing and monitoring LLM behavior. The research highlights the ongoing arms race between AI security measures and sophisticated attack techniques.
